摘要
化工分离是化工生产过程中非常重要的一环。传统的精馏技术在分离效率和能源消耗方面存在一定的问题。为了解决这些问题,多效精馏技术应运而生。多效精馏是一种高效节能的分离技术,通过多次蒸汽压缩和回收利用废热,实现能源的最大化利用。综述多效精馏的原理和工艺流程,并分析其节能效果。同时,探讨多效精馏在石油化工、化学工业中的应用,并通过案例分析来验证其实际效果。
Chemical separation is a very important part in the process of chemical production.Traditional distillation technology has some problems in separation efficiency and energy consumption.In order to solve these problems,multi-effect distillation technology came into being.Multi-effect distillation is an energy-efficient separation technology that maximizes energy use through multiple steam compression and recovery of waste heat.In this paper,the principle and process flow of multi-effect distillation are reviewed,and its energy-saving effect is analyzed.At the same time,the application of multi-effect distillation in petrochemical and chemical industry is discussed,and its practical effect is verified by case analysis.
